Evolution of Privateness Rules and Information Safety Legal guidelines by 2026, Contemplating the Influence of Synthetic Intelligence and Machine Studying
By 2026, the regulatory panorama can have undergone a big transformation, pushed by the necessity to tackle the distinctive challenges posed by AI and ML. Present frameworks, equivalent to GDPR, CCPA, and others, can have been up to date and refined, whereas new legal guidelines and laws can have emerged. These will possible concentrate on:
- AI-Particular Rules: Legal guidelines particularly focusing on the event and deployment of AI techniques might be commonplace. These laws will possible tackle algorithmic bias, transparency in AI decision-making, and the fitting to rationalization. For example, firms is likely to be required to reveal how AI techniques are used to make choices that influence people, offering clear explanations of the logic behind the outcomes.
- Information Minimization and Goal Limitation: Rules will emphasize information minimization, requiring organizations to gather solely the information mandatory for a selected function and to restrict its use to that function. This might be essential in mitigating the dangers related to large-scale information breaches and misuse.
- Enhanced Consent Mechanisms: The idea of “knowledgeable consent” will evolve, with extra granular and user-friendly consent mechanisms. It will embrace choices for people to selectively consent to using their information for particular functions, slightly than a blanket settlement.
- Cross-Border Information Transfers: Worldwide information switch mechanisms might be below fixed scrutiny. New agreements and frameworks might be wanted to make sure information safety requirements are maintained when information is transferred throughout borders, significantly given the worldwide nature of AI improvement and deployment.
- Accountability and Enforcement: Enforcement mechanisms might be strengthened, with elevated fines and penalties for non-compliance. Information safety authorities might be given extra sources and authority to research and prosecute violations.
The influence of AI and ML on privateness legal guidelines is profound. AI techniques can analyze huge quantities of knowledge to deduce delicate details about people, equivalent to their well being, monetary standing, and political opinions. This necessitates a proactive strategy to information safety, specializing in stopping the gathering and use of knowledge that may very well be used to discriminate towards or manipulate people.Take into account the case of healthcare.

Measures People and Organizations May Take to Shield Their Private Data from Unauthorized Entry, Utilizing a Step-by-Step Process
Defending private info in 2026 would require a multi-layered strategy, involving each particular person actions and organizational insurance policies. Here is a step-by-step process:
- Particular person Actions:
- Strengthen Passwords and Authentication: Use robust, distinctive passwords for all on-line accounts and allow multi-factor authentication (MFA) at any time when attainable. MFA provides an additional layer of safety by requiring a second type of verification, equivalent to a code despatched to your cellphone.
- Be Aware of Information Sharing: Fastidiously take into account what private info you share on-line and with whom. Keep away from oversharing on social media and be cautious about offering private info to unfamiliar web sites or providers.
- Repeatedly Evaluation Privateness Settings: Evaluation the privateness settings on all of your on-line accounts and units, and replace them frequently to mirror your present preferences. Many platforms supply privateness dashboards that will let you management how your information is used.
- Use Privateness-Enhancing Applied sciences: Make use of instruments equivalent to VPNs (Digital Personal Networks) to encrypt your web site visitors and browse the online extra securely. Use privacy-focused browsers and serps.
- Keep Knowledgeable About Information Breaches: Monitor information and safety alerts for details about information breaches which will have an effect on your accounts. In case your information is compromised, take speedy motion to vary passwords and safe your accounts.
- Organizational Insurance policies:
- Implement Information Encryption: Encrypt all delicate information, each in transit and at relaxation. Encryption transforms information into an unreadable format, defending it from unauthorized entry even when an information breach happens.
- Set up Entry Controls: Implement strict entry controls to restrict entry to delicate information to solely licensed personnel. This consists of utilizing role-based entry management (RBAC) and the precept of least privilege, which grants customers solely the minimal mandatory entry rights.
- Conduct Common Safety Audits and Penetration Testing: Repeatedly audit your safety techniques and conduct penetration testing to determine and tackle vulnerabilities. This entails simulating assaults to evaluate the effectiveness of your safety measures.
- Present Worker Coaching: Practice workers on information safety greatest practices, together with easy methods to determine and reply to phishing assaults, easy methods to deal with delicate information securely, and the significance of knowledge privateness.
- Develop a Information Breach Response Plan: Create a complete information breach response plan that Artikels the steps to be taken within the occasion of an information breach, together with easy methods to notify affected people, mitigate the harm, and stop future incidents.
A vital facet is the implementation of zero-trust safety fashions, which assume that no consumer or machine, inside or outdoors the community, ought to be trusted by default. Each entry request is verified, guaranteeing that solely licensed customers and units can entry information and sources.

State of affairs Depicting the Moral Dilemmas Confronted by Expertise Firms in Balancing Information Safety and Consumer Privateness, Highlighting Potential Options and Challenges
Think about a number one social media platform, “ConnectNow,” in ConnectNow has developed an AI-powered content material suggestion system that makes use of huge quantities of consumer information to personalize content material feeds. This technique considerably will increase consumer engagement, resulting in larger promoting income. Nonetheless, the system additionally raises a number of moral dilemmas:
- Algorithmic Bias: The AI system is skilled on historic information that displays current societal biases. This results in the system amplifying these biases, creating echo chambers and probably selling discriminatory content material. For instance, if the coaching information accommodates stereotypes about sure ethnic teams, the AI would possibly advocate content material that reinforces these stereotypes.
- Information Safety vs. Function Improvement: ConnectNow faces strain to gather extra consumer information to enhance the AI system’s accuracy and personalize suggestions additional. Nonetheless, this will increase the chance of knowledge breaches and the potential for misuse of consumer information.
- Transparency and Explainability: The complicated nature of the AI system makes it tough to elucidate to customers how suggestions are generated and why they see sure content material. This lack of transparency undermines consumer belief and makes it tough for customers to regulate their on-line expertise.
Potential options and challenges:
- Options:
- Bias Mitigation Methods: Implement strategies to determine and mitigate bias within the AI system. This might contain utilizing numerous datasets, adjusting algorithms to account for bias, and actively monitoring the system’s output for biased content material.
- Information Minimization: Undertake an information minimization strategy, accumulating solely the information mandatory to supply the core service. This reduces the chance of knowledge breaches and the potential for misuse of consumer information.
- Explainable AI (XAI): Spend money on XAI strategies to make the AI system’s decision-making course of extra clear. This might contain offering customers with explanations of why they see sure content material and permitting them to regulate their preferences.
- Unbiased Audits: Conduct common, impartial audits of the AI system to evaluate its efficiency and determine potential moral points.
- Challenges:
- Balancing Accuracy and Equity: Mitigating bias can typically scale back the accuracy of the AI system, requiring a cautious steadiness between equity and efficiency.
- Information Assortment vs. Consumer Expertise: Information minimization can restrict the power to personalize consumer experiences, probably resulting in decrease engagement and decreased promoting income.
- Technical Complexity: Implementing XAI strategies could be technically complicated and resource-intensive.
- Regulatory Uncertainty: The quickly evolving regulatory panorama creates uncertainty and makes it tough for firms to adjust to all relevant legal guidelines and laws.
ConnectNow’s moral dilemma underscores the necessity for a proactive and accountable strategy to information privateness.

Methods and Instruments Employed by Potential Leakers, Jolie becker leaks 2026
Potential leakers make use of a various vary of strategies, usually combining them for max effectiveness. Understanding these strategies is essential for figuring out and mitigating potential vulnerabilities.
- Social Engineering: Manipulating people into divulging delicate info is a standard tactic. This could contain phishing, pretexting, or impersonation.
- Instance: A leaker would possibly impersonate an IT assist workers member to acquire a consumer’s login credentials or use a convincing electronic mail to trick somebody into clicking a malicious hyperlink.
- Hacking: Exploiting vulnerabilities in techniques and networks permits leakers to achieve unauthorized entry to information. This could contain malware, ransomware, and different malicious software program.
- Instance: Zero-day exploits, which goal beforehand unknown vulnerabilities, are significantly harmful. A profitable assault utilizing such an exploit can grant full management of a system.
- Insider Threats: People with licensed entry to delicate info can deliberately or unintentionally leak information. This may be the results of negligence, malicious intent, or coercion.
- Instance: A disgruntled worker would possibly copy delicate recordsdata onto a USB drive after which leak them to the media or promote them on the darkish net.
- Bodily Entry: Gaining bodily entry to an organization’s premises or units permits leakers to steal information straight.
- Instance: A leaker would possibly steal a laptop computer containing delicate information or achieve entry to a server room.
- Provide Chain Assaults: Compromising third-party distributors or suppliers to achieve entry to a goal group’s information.
- Instance: A leaker would possibly compromise the software program of a vendor utilized by a big firm to put in malware on the corporate’s techniques.
